Investigation of methylation and expression levels of thioredoxin interacting protein (TXNIP) gene in oral squamous cell carcinoma

Abstract (EN)
Investigation of Expression and Methylation Levels of Thioredoxin Interacting Protein (TXNIP) Gene in Oral Squamous Cell Carcinoma Objecktive: In this study, methylation and expression levels of Thioredoxin Interacting Protein (TXNIP) gene, which was determined to show decrease in expression due to methylation by Prof. Dr. Semra Demokan et al. in their project's array results with TÜBİTAK-114S497 number, was studied in a wider group of patients with oral squamous cell carcinoma (OSCC). By developing an invasive/noninvasive method, we aim to define the usability of TXNIP as a biomarker for diagnosis / early diagnosis of oral squamous cell carcinoma Material and Method: In our study, tumor, normal and serum samples of 50 patients who were diagnosed and operated for OSCC in Istanbul Faculty of Medicine, Department of Otolaryngology & Head and Neck Surgery and normal mucosal tissue and serum samples of 10 healthy volunteers were collected. After isolation of DNA, ratio of methylation and expression of TXNIP gene and downregulation of expression ratio due to methylation were investigated. Quantitative Methylation Specific Polymerase Chain Reaction (QMSP) method was used to show methylation and Quantitative Real Time PCR (QRT-PCR) method was used to define the expression levels. Results: After the analysis, a decrease in TXNIP expression levels was found in 30 (60%) patients compared to normal tissue. While methylation in the promoter area was determined in 9 (18%) patients, only one normal tissue was found to have methylation. In 6 of 9 (67%) patients in whom methylation was observed, a decrease in expression levels was also observed. In 1 of 6 patients in whom decrease in expression due to methylation was found, methylation in normal tissue and serum samples was found. No methylation was found in healthy subjects. In OSCC patients with methylation, expression of the gene was found 89 times lower than the healthy population. In OSCC patients without methylation, expression of the gene was found 35 times lower than the healthy population. Conclusion: For the TXNIP gene that shows no methylation in healthy population, after studies with higher volumes of OSCC patients, it is possible to use this gene as a biomarker for OSCC diagnosis/early diagnosis and follow-up.
